Choose vectorflow if…
- vectorflow is primarily Python; infinity is C++.
- Tags unique to vectorflow: ai, data-engineering, embeddings, machine-learning.
- vectorflow ships Docker support for self-hosted deployment.
- - When your project requires handling large volumes of data that need to be transformed into vector embeddings efficiently.
When NOT to use vectorflow
- - If your application only deals with small datasets and does not benefit from high-volume processing capabilities offered by VectorFlow.
- - When the specific requirements of your project mandate using a single, particular vector database system as opposed to leveraging multiple options(VectorFlow provides).
Choose infinity if…
- infinity is primarily C++; vectorflow is Python.
- Tags unique to infinity: ai-native, approximate-nearest-neighbor-search, bm25, cpp20.
- When your application requires rapid hybrid search capabilities across multiple data types including tensors and full texts.
When NOT to use infinity
- If your project does not benefit from fast hybrid search features or if you prefer not to use an AI-native database solution.
- When support for only dense vectors is sufficient, and the added complexity of supporting tensors and full texts is unnecessary.
